Our client is looking to welcome an ambitious person to join their growing Manufacturing & Warehouse team in Peterlee as a Lean Manufacturing Apprentice (Tape Edger).

Duties will include:

  • Ensuring mattresses are produced to the correct specification
  • Maintaining a safe working environment and adhering to health and safety regulations
  • Operating machinery and production line equipment
  • Performing quality checks and inspections to ensure finished goods are in line with quality policy
  • Performing routine maintenance on equipment
  • Reporting any defects or issues to management
  • Meeting production targets and deadlines
  • Always maintaining a clean and tidy workspace
  • Complying with all company policies and procedures including ISO and making recommendations for continuous improvements
  • Any other reasonable tasks as required by the management team

Required knowledge, skills and experience:

  • Previous warehouse experience is not essential
  • Must be able to pass pre-employment tests including Drug & Alcohol
  • Flexibility in working hours during busy periods (Core hours are 9am - 5pm but 8am starts are sometimes required)
  • Ability to work in an organised manner, cleaning as you go
  • Team work
